Fox News: Seattle agrees to pay BLM protesters $10 million in lawsuit stemming from 2020 riots
Seattle will pay Black Lives Matter protesters $10 million in a settlement for excessive police force during 2020 protests.
The protesters experienced injuries including broken bones, hearing loss, and emotional damage.

Breitbart: Hollywood Streaming Carnage: NBCUniversal's Peacock Lost $2.7 Billion in 2023
Peacock, NBCUniversal's streaming service, suffered losses of $2.7 billion in 2023, relying heavily on Paramount's series Yellowstone. Despite promoting new shows like Ted, Peacock has struggled to generate popular enthusiasm. The streaming service also carries MSNBC's programming but has faced financial struggles in the competitive streaming market.

Fox News: Norwegian cruise passengers brought bags of weed on ship in transatlantic drug trafficking scheme: authorities
Two passengers on a Norwegian Cruise Line ship were arrested for allegedly bringing more than 100 bags of marijuana on board. The drugs were discovered in vacuum-sealed bags in their luggage. The authorities believe drug traffickers are exporting marijuana from the US to England.

Breitbart: REPORT: Lia Thomas Secretly Challenging Trans Swimming Ban
Transgender swimmer Lia Thomas is challenging the ban on men competing in women's races. She has approached the Court of Arbitration for Sport to overturn the ban, which was put in place by World Aquatics. Thomas' rise to the top of women's collegiate swimming has sparked controversy and raised concerns about the safety and welfare of female swimmers.
